Full job description

Position: Finance & Administrative Operations Director

Level: Senior Director or Director – Finance & Administrative Operations Director

North Carolina Association of Educators

Reports to: Executive Director

Classification: Full-time, exempt, senior director

Location: Raleigh, North Carolina (occasional travel required)

Preferred Start Date: By October 1st

About NCAE

The North Carolina Association of Educators (NCAE) is the state's largest professional association and union representing educators and education support professionals. As an affiliate of the National Education Association, NCAE advocates for public education, champions the rights and working conditions of education employees, and works to ensure every student in North Carolina has access to a great public school. NCAE pursues its mission through member organizing, legislative and political action, collective advocacy, professional development, and coalition building.

Position Summary

The Finance & Administrative Operations Director (FAOD) serves as NCAE's senior director responsible for the stewardship of the Association's financial, administrative, human resource, technology, facilities, and operational infrastructure. Reporting to the Executive Director, the FAOD reviews, analyzes, and evaluates all matters relative to the financial interests of NCAE and working with consulting partners and vendors advises the Executive Director, the President, the Board of Directors, and the Budget and Finance Committee.

The FAOD directs and supervises a team of experienced accounting, finance, human resources, technology, and membership professionals, and ensures that the Association's operations support and advance its organizing and strategic priorities. The FAOD participates in the collective bargaining process with the staff union alongside the Executive Director and President and serves as a key advisor on the long-term financial sustainability of the organization.

Departments & Functions Supervised

The FA0D directs the following departments and functions:

  • Business, Finance & Accounting
  • Human Resources/Payroll
  • Information Technology & Data Systems
  • Membership Processing & Membership Systems
  • Investment Management
  • Facilities & Administrative Services

Primary Responsibilities

Financial Leadership

  • Maintain an effective accounting system and provide overall administration and management of the accounting function, including budget formulation and execution, treasury, payroll, audit, and financial reporting.
  • Provide Strategic Budget, Income Statement, Balance Sheet, Cash Flow Analysis, and Membership Status (counts and dues receivable) reports
  • Direct multi-year financial planning aligned with the Association's organizing and strategic priorities.
  • Oversee membership dues processing and accounting, and the financial administration of 

NCAE-PAC and related political funds in compliance with applicable law.

  • Lead the annual audit process and serve as the primary staff liaison to external auditors and the Budget and Finance Committee.
  • Work with investment consultant(s) to leverage financial resources to meet the organizational strategic plan needs

 

Organizational Leadership

  • Serves on Executive level leadership team
  • Develop operational strategies that advance the Board’s long-term goals
  • Advises the Executive Director, President, Board of Directors, and Finance & Personnel Committee on the financial position, risks, and opportunities of the Association
  • Integrate data analytics within assigned departments and ensure inclusion within executive team meetings 

Administration & Human Resources

  • Oversee human resources functions including workforce planning, recruitment, benefits, employee relations, and compliance.
  • Participate in the collective bargaining process with the staff union and support the administration of collective bargaining agreements.
  • Serve as Plan Administrator for staff retirement and benefit plans.
  • Provide consultation, advice, training, and assistance to staff and local affiliates regarding their administrative and financial operations.

Technology, Risk & Operations

  • Oversee information technology, cybersecurity, enterprise systems, and data governance.
  • Manage organizational risk, insurance, internal controls, and regulatory compliance.
  • Oversee facilities and administrative services to ensure safe, efficient, and cost-effective operations.

 

Qualifications

NCAE seeks a strategic, mission-driven financial leader with deep experience in nonprofit, union, public school, or membership-organization finance and administration.

Required

  • At least ten (7) years of progressively responsible financial leadership experience at a nonprofit organization, union, educational institution, association, school district, or other large membership organization.
  • At least (5) years of experience in an organization reporting up through a CFO or equivalent, with responsibility for budget development and oversight at or above $12 million dollars in expenditure
  • Prior experience serving on a senior leadership team in an organization of similar size and complexity 
  • CPA, MBA, or advanced degree in a relevant field
  • Demonstrated expertise in nonprofit accounting standards, audit, budgeting, treasury, and internal controls.
  • Experience in transitioning enterprise resource planning
  • Staff management experience of at least 5 years, including a preference in experience in a union workplace and experience negotiating and enforcing a collective bargaining agreement
  • Commitment to the mission of public education and the labor movement

Preferred

  • Experience supervising multidisciplinary teams across finance, HR, IT, and operations.
  • Experience with labor unions.
  • Experience working with and advising a Board of Directors
  • Experience participating in collective bargaining with a staff union.
  • Familiarity with PAC and campaign finance compliance.

Working Conditions

  • Work is performed primarily in an office environment in Raleigh, with periodic in-state travel and one to two national events.
  • Ability to work extended and irregular hours, including some evenings and weekends, during budget cycles, audits, and organizational events such as Board meetings
  • Valid driver's license and ability to travel to affiliate offices and worksites as needed.

Compensation & Benefits

NCAE offers a competitive salary commensurate with experience and competitive with above market retirement benefits, a defined-benefit pension plan, and a comprehensive benefits package including medical, dental, and vision coverage, generous paid leave and holidays, employer provided FSA/HRA monies, expense reimbursements, 401k plan, life insurance and LTD, and professional development support.

Vision Statement - An equitable quality public education for every child Mission Statement - To be the voice of educators in North Carolina that unites, organizes and empowers members to be advocates for public education and children. Core Values Equal Access - We value equal access to a quality public education that is adequately and equitably funded. Diversity - We value a just society that respects the worth, dignity and equality of every individual. Collective Action - We value an informed membership that works collectively to advance and protect the rights, benefits and interests of education professionals and promote quality public education. Partnerships - We value partnerships with parents, families and communities, as well as coalitions with other stakeholders because they are essential to quality public education and student success. Professionalism - We value the expertise and judgment of educational professionals and believe it is critical for student success. We maintain the highest professional standards and expect the status, compensation and respect due all professionals. Shared Responsibility - We value a collaborative community of members and staff who share the responsibility of achieving NCAE’s goals.
